【JZOJ5406】Tree

Description

给定一颗n 个点的树,树边带权,试求一个排列P,使下式的值最大

i=1n1maxflow(Pi,Pi+1)

其中maxflow(s; t) 表示从点s 到点t 之间的最大流,即从s 到t 的路径上最小的边权

Solution

结论:答案等于边权之和。
可以通过构造法感性理解:我们在当前树找到一条最小的边,那么经过这条边的路径只能有一条,于是把这条边拆掉,分成两棵树,继续往下做可以发现是对的(好像是吧)。

posted @ 2017-10-16 18:17  sadstone  阅读(30)  评论(0编辑  收藏  举报